vimarsana.com
Home
Skehan Home Center Center Ossipee Nh
Top Locations Tagged with Skehan Home Center Center Ossipee Nh
Skehan Home Center Center Ossipee Nh in United States - 03814/Hardware-store near Carroll
1). Skehan Home Center
2). Skehan Home Center Inc, Route E
3). Skehan Home Center Inc, RR
vimarsana © 2020. All Rights Reserved.